Behavior4/5

Does the description disclose side effects, auth requirements, rate limits, or destructive behavior?

It discloses important behavior beyond the annotations: permanent config vs session-only token, and the no-argument behavior of returning a login link. There is no contradiction with the annotations, though it does not describe what happens on invalid tokens or how the tool reports success/failure.

Agents need to know what a tool does to the world before calling it. Descriptions should go beyond structured annotations to explain consequences.

Conciseness4/5

Is the description appropriately sized, front-loaded, and free of redundancy?

The description is appropriately compact and front-loaded: it states the purpose, then the permanent setup, then the session-only invocation options. The phrasing is slightly awkward in places, but every clause adds meaningful guidance.

Shorter descriptions cost fewer tokens and are easier for agents to parse. Every sentence should earn its place.

Completeness4/5

Given the tool's complexity, does the description cover enough for an agent to succeed on first attempt?

For a one-parameter authentication tool with sparse annotations and no output schema, the description provides enough context to use the tool for permanent configuration, session-based login, and link retrieval. It could be more explicit about exact response behavior and error cases, but it is largely complete.

Complex tools with many parameters or behaviors need more documentation. Simple tools need less. This dimension scales expectations accordingly.

Parameters5/5

Does the description clarify parameter syntax, constraints, interactions, or defaults beyond what the schema provides?

The input schema only defines 'token' as a string with no description, but this description adds key semantics: the token is an access JWT, it is optional, it is used for session-only login, and omitting it returns a login link. This is strong compensation for the 0% schema description coverage.

Input schemas describe structure but not intent. Descriptions should explain non-obvious parameter relationships and valid value ranges.

Purpose4/5

Does the description clearly state what the tool does and how it differs from similar tools?

The description clearly identifies the tool as an authentication flow for MCP.AI in IDE agents: the user logs in through the browser, obtains an access token, and either configures it permanently or passes it to the tool. It does not explicitly contrast itself with the sibling tool 'connect', so it narrowly misses full differentiation.

Agents choose between tools based on descriptions. A clear purpose with a specific verb and resource helps agents select the right tool.

Usage Guidelines4/5

Does the description explain when to use this tool, when not to, or what alternatives exist?

The description gives clear usage branches: use the config header for a permanent connection or call the tool with a token for session-only login, and call with no arguments to receive the login link. It does not explicitly address when not to use the tool or name alternatives.

Agents often have multiple tools that could apply. Explicit usage guidance like "use X instead of Y when Z" prevents misuse.
